如何使用DSP技术实现直流无刷电机的PWM调速控制,并通过霍尔传感器实现电机转向和转速的精确控制?
时间: 2024-11-11 13:19:34 浏览: 46
在设计直流无刷电机的控制系统时,DSP技术起着至关重要的作用。通过使用DSP技术,可以实现对电机的精确控制和实时监控。在本问题中,我们将探讨如何使用DSP技术来实现直流无刷电机的PWM调速控制,并结合霍尔传感器来实现电机转向和转速的精确控制。
参考资源链接:[东南大学DSP实验报告:直流无刷电机控制与调速](https://wenku.csdn.net/doc/648fa3b49aecc961cb13778c?spm=1055.2569.3001.10343)
首先,DSP技术在电机控制中的应用包括数字信号处理、电机控制算法的实现和实时数据采集。在这个实验中,我们将使用TMS320F28335 DSP芯片作为控制核心,利用其高速处理能力和丰富的外设接口。
PWM波形的产生是电机调速的关键。在DSP中,PWM波形可以通过编程定时器模块来生成,并通过调整PWM的占空比来控制电机的速度。在本实验中,可以利用TI提供的drvlib281x库来简化PWM波形的产生和控制过程。
接下来,霍尔传感器的使用对于无刷直流电机来说至关重要,它能够提供电机的转子位置信息,从而实现精确的转速和转向控制。通过读取霍尔传感器的输出信号,DSP可以准确判断转子的当前位置,并在适当的时刻切换电机绕组的电流,以保持电机的连续运转。
除此之外,实验还包括了电位器控制和液晶屏显示的设计。电位器可以提供模拟信号,通过ADC转换为数字信号,DSP根据该信号调整PWM的占空比,从而实现电机速度的连续调节。液晶屏显示则用于展示电机的实时状态信息,例如转速和转向等,这需要DSP与液晶屏之间的通信协议。
最后,人机交互界面的实现也是实验的一个重要部分。通过小键盘或触摸屏,用户可以输入指令来控制电机的正转、反转和停止。DSP需要能够接收这些指令,并将其转换为相应的控制信号输出给电机驱动电路。
通过综合运用上述技术,学生将能够完成一个基于DSP技术的直流无刷电机控制系统的设计和实现。推荐查看《东南大学DSP实验报告:直流无刷电机控制与调速》,该报告详细讲解了这些概念和技术的应用,并提供了完整的实验代码和步骤,对于深入理解DSP在电机控制领域的应用具有极大的帮助。
参考资源链接:[东南大学DSP实验报告:直流无刷电机控制与调速](https://wenku.csdn.net/doc/648fa3b49aecc961cb13778c?spm=1055.2569.3001.10343)
阅读全文